pgbouncer
« Back to VersTracker
Description:
Lightweight connection pooler for PostgreSQL
Type: Formula  |  Latest Version: 1.25.1@0  |  Tracked Since: Nov 22, 2025
Links: Homepage  |  formulae.brew.sh
Category: Databases
Tags: postgresql connection-pooling database proxy performance
Install: brew install pgbouncer
About:
PgBouncer is a lightweight, production-ready connection pooler for PostgreSQL. It reduces connection overhead by maintaining a pool of backend connections and efficiently routing client requests. This significantly improves performance and resource utilization for high-traffic applications.
Key Features:
  • Session, transaction, and statement pooling modes
  • Minimal memory footprint (2MB per connection)
  • Support for TLS/SSL and authentication
  • Detailed statistics via console and SNMP
  • Online configuration reload without dropping connections
Use Cases:
  • Reducing database connection overhead for web applications
  • Consolidating connections from microservices
  • Protecting PostgreSQL servers from connection storms
  • Running connection-intensive applications like PgBench
Alternatives:
  • odyssey – Modern multi-threaded pooler with advanced routing and performance features
  • pgpool-II – Feature-rich proxy with load balancing, replication, and parallel query support
Version History
Detected Version Rev Change Commit
Nov 22, 2025 11:13pm 0 VERSION_BUMP a27b0886
Nov 9, 2025 3:30pm 0 VERSION_BUMP 7d0a4bf5
Jan 10, 2025 12:46pm 0 VERSION_BUMP 84d42a9e
Jan 10, 2025 11:04am 0 VERSION_BUMP c246ea2f